wīn-tunne, f.n: a wine cask. (WEEN-TUN-nuh / ˈwiːn-ˌtʌn-nə)

geohsa
geohsa, m.n: hiccup; sob, sobbing. (YEH-o-h’sa / ˈjɛɔh-sa)

ymb-spenning
ymb-spenning, f.n: allurement, enticement. (UMB-SPEN-ning / ˈɝmb-ˌspɛn-nɪŋ)
snōd
snōd, f.n: snood, headdress. (SNOAD / ˈsnoːd)
of-tredan
of-tredan, str.v: to tread down, trample upon, injure or destroy by treading. (off-TREH-dahn / ɔf-ˈtrɛ-dan)
chor
chor, m.n: a dance, chorus, choir. (K’HOR / ˈkhɔr)

cēasega
cēasega, m.n: a chooser. (CHAY-ah-zeh-ga / ˈtʃeːa-zɛ-ga)
sǣ-næss
sǣ-næss, m.n: a ness or promontory stretching into the sea, a cape. (SAE-nass / ˈsæː-næs)
wyrt
wyrt, f.n: plant, herb. (WUERT / ˈwyrt)

fōre-stæppung
fōre-stæppung, f.n: a stepping before, preventing, anticipation. (FOH-ruh-STAP-pung / ˈfoː-rə-ˌstæp-pʌŋ)
